Output e5dc4033600c866266d65ac2befb375ca26a4e3d68e69f9ee1752e247c1d489c:4

value
399197415
script pubkey
OP_0 OP_PUSHBYTES_20 fb7e100317274751c099310f42dc3b43ee05626e
address
bc1qldlpqqchyar4rsyexy859hpmg0hq2cnw9znvyh
transaction
e5dc4033600c866266d65ac2befb375ca26a4e3d68e69f9ee1752e247c1d489c
confirmations
327493
spent
true